Lassen Sie uns über den Job sprechen
Bei uns finden Sie spannende Jobs und Projekte für unterschiedliche Fachgebiete. Wir sind tätig in den Bereichen Festanstellung, freiberufliche Projekte und Zeitarbeit. Laden Sie einfach Ihr Profil hoch und wir melden uns umgehend. Sollte für Sie kein passender Job dabei sein, so freuen wir uns über Ihre Initiativbewerbung.
Passt das zu Ihnen?
AFRA-4397 - Java-Entwickler (m/w/d) (DE)
[7730]
Java, Softwareentwicklung, Microservices
Projekt-/Aufgabenbeschreibung: ·Programmierung / Implementierung / Customizing technischer Komponenten in Applikationen auf Basis der genutzten Technologien inkl. dazugehöriger Schnittstellen, Module und entsprechender Datenbanken unter Einhaltung der Standards des Auftraggebers (z.B. Nutzung der standardisierten Entwicklungsumgebungen und Programmierrichtlinien) ·Beheben von Fehlern aus den Testphasen in den Applikationen / KomponentenDokumentation der technischen Komponenten ·Erstellen von Systemdokumentationen ·Erstellen von Lieferpaketen für die betreffenden Applikationen ·Einrichten von Entwicklungsumgebungen incl. Continuous Integration ·Durchführen von Code-Reviews, Komponententests, Modultests, Modulgruppentests ·Vorbereitung von Entscheidungsvorlagen zu technischen Themen ·Präsentationen zu technisch komplexen Themenstellungen ·Berichten von Risiken und Problemen an die technischen Architekten und an das Projektmanagement Anforderungen – must have: ·Software Entwicklung (jeweils mind. 3 Jahre): • Java • Spring Boot • RabbitMQ • Kubernetes • Relationale Datenbanken (bspw. MongoDB, SQL) ·1 Jahr Erfahrung in der agilen Softwareentwicklung nach der Scrum Methode ·3 Jahre Erfahrung in der Entwicklung von serviceorientierten Architekturen, im Idealfall Microservices ·3 Jahre Erfahrung in der Entwicklung cloudbasierter Systeme (z.B. AWS) ·2 Projektreferenzen zu Implementierungsleistungen in mittleren und kleinen Projekten
Projekt-/Aufgabenbeschreibung:
- Programmierung / Implementierung / Customizing technischer Komponenten in Applikationen auf Basis der genutzten Technologien inkl. dazugehöriger Schnittstellen, Module und entsprechender Datenbanken unter Einhaltung der Standards des Auftraggebers (z.B. Nutzung der standardisierten Entwicklungsumgebungen und Programmierrichtlinien)
- Beheben von Fehlern aus den Testphasen in den Applikationen / KomponentenDokumentation der technischen Komponenten
- Erstellen von Systemdokumentationen
- Erstellen von Lieferpaketen für die betreffenden Applikationen
- Einrichten von Entwicklungsumgebungen incl. Continuous Integration
- Durchführen von Code-Reviews, Komponententests, Modultests, Modulgruppentests
- Vorbereitung von Entscheidungsvorlagen zu technischen Themen
- Präsentationen zu technisch komplexen Themenstellungen
- Berichten von Risiken und Problemen an die technischen Architekten und an das
Projektmanagement
Anforderungen – must have:
- Software Entwicklung (jeweils mind. 3 Jahre):
• Java
• Spring Boot
• RabbitMQ
• Kubernetes
• Relationale Datenbanken (bspw. MongoDB, SQL) - 1 Jahr Erfahrung in der agilen Softwareentwicklung nach der Scrum Methode
- 3 Jahre Erfahrung in der Entwicklung von serviceorientierten Architekturen, im
Idealfall Microservices - 3 Jahre Erfahrung in der Entwicklung cloudbasierter Systeme (z.B. AWS)
- 2 Projektreferenzen zu Implementierungsleistungen in mittleren und kleinen Projekten